At Fontaine Lake Camp on Lake Athabasca in northern Canada, history shows that about 25% of the guests catch lake trout over 20 pounds on a 4-day fishing trip. Let n be a random variable that represents the first trip to Fontaine Lake Camp on which a guest catches a lake trout over 20 pounds. (a) Write out a formula for the probability distribution of the random variable n. (b) Find the probability that a guest catches a lake trout weighing at least 20 pounds for the first time on trip number 3. () (c) Find the probability that it takes more than three trips for a guest to catch a lake trout weighing at least 20 pounds. () (d) What is the expected number of fishing trips that must be taken to catch the first lake trout over 20 pounds?

Explanation / Answer

this is a geomteric distribution

a)P(n) =(0.75)n-1*0.25

b)from above formual probability P(n=3) =(0.75)2*0.25 =0.141

c)probabilty P(n>3) = no success in first 3 attempts =(0.75)3 =0.422

d)expected numbr =1/p =1/0.25 =4
